## Further Reading

Incremental rebuilds in Lanternpress only regenerate pages whose content hashes changed, which is why a support ticket about a "stale page" usually traces back to a missed dependency edge rather than a cache bug. Before escalating, confirm the dependency graph was refreshed after the last content import. The complete explanation of the rebuild pipeline and common failure modes lives on the page below.

wiki page, tahaf-tajog: https://jira.ordindyn.corp/pipeline

Subject: Handover — order cutoff weirdness

Taking over Crumbwell on-call? One open item: the 14:00 order-cutoff rule misfired yesterday and accepted two late bakery orders. Suspect timezone handling in the cutoff evaluator after the Fernvale region launch. Orders were honored manually; no customer impact. Fix is drafted, not merged. Don't toggle the cutoff flag yourself. Questions about the evaluator should go to the fulfillment team.

pager mailbox: druius.ruswyn.norael@nelvroio.test

Quick onboarding note for the eng sync: user-supplied formulas in Tallygrove now run inside the Crucible sandbox — no filesystem, no network, 50ms budget. Anything weirder gets rejected before evaluation. If you're testing escapes or timeouts, hit the sandbox's internal eval endpoint directly rather than the public API. To authenticate against that internal endpoint, use the key below:

gateway credential: kto23_LX9A4ys6i4nzHtpOLNLodKK

Subject: Quickstore 4.2 — bloom filter now fronts the KV layer

Plugin authors: starting with this release, Quickstore places a bloom filter ahead of the key-value store. Negative lookups return faster; false positives fall through safely. No API changes are required on your side. Verify your plugin against the staging build referenced below.

session token of fahif-tadup = htk3_9c7